The Basic Plot: A Quick Overview
At its core, The Wrong Boy Next Door revolves around a seemingly normal teenage boy who moves in next door and quickly becomes the object of obsession for a teenage girl. However, things take a dark turn as his behavior becomes increasingly unsettling and dangerous. The film explores themes of obsession, manipulation, and the hidden dangers that can lurk beneath a charming facade.
The movie unfolds with the introduction of the protagonist, often a young woman named Kelly, who is at a vulnerable point in her life. Maybe she's dealing with family issues, academic stress, or the typical angst of adolescence. Enter the new neighbor, a boy who initially seems like the perfect friend or even something more. He's attentive, supportive, and always there to lend an ear. But as the story progresses, his attentiveness morphs into something more sinister. Small gestures become grand manipulations, and innocent favors turn into dangerous demands.
As Kelly starts to realize that something is amiss, she tries to distance herself, but by then, she's already entangled in his web. The boy's obsession escalates, leading to stalking, threats, and attempts to isolate her from her friends and family. The tension builds as Kelly desperately tries to break free and expose his true nature before it's too late. The climax usually involves a confrontation where Kelly must outsmart her tormentor and reclaim her life. Throughout the film, viewers are kept on edge, questioning the true motives of each character and wondering how far the boy will go to get what he wants. The Wrong Boy Next Door isn't just a thriller; it's a cautionary tale about the importance of trust, boundaries, and recognizing the red flags in relationships.

Diving Deeper: Themes and Messages
The Wrong Boy Next Door isn't just about cheap thrills; it touches on some serious themes:
- Obsession: How quickly admiration can turn into something dangerous.
- Manipulation: The subtle ways someone can control another person.
- Trust: Who can you really trust, and how do you spot the warning signs?
- Teenage Vulnerability: The unique challenges and pressures faced by young adults.
These themes elevate the movie beyond a simple thriller, prompting viewers to reflect on their own relationships and boundaries. Obsession is portrayed not as a romantic pursuit but as a destructive force that can consume and control a person's life. Manipulation is depicted as a gradual process, where small concessions lead to larger compromises of one's autonomy. The theme of trust is constantly questioned, forcing viewers to consider the importance of discernment and skepticism in forming relationships. Furthermore, the film highlights the specific vulnerabilities of teenagers, who may lack the experience and resources to recognize and address manipulative behavior. By exploring these themes, The Wrong Boy Next Door offers a compelling and thought-provoking commentary on the complexities of human relationships and the importance of self-awareness.
